Kate Farms is a company that produces organic, plant-based nutrition shakes and formulas designed to support a variety of dietary needs and health conditions. Their products are made with high-quality ingredients, free from common allergens, and are easy to digest, making them suitable for individuals with food sensitivities. Kate Farms' offerings are available for both children and adults, and include everyday nutrition products as well as specialized medical nutrition for specific health conditions like malnutrition and pediatric GI issues. Their products are certified USDA Organic, Non-GMO Project Verified, and they work with insurers to help customers obtain coverage through Medicare, Medicaid, and private insurance plans. Kate Farms is committed to making nutrition a foundation of health and offers a subscription service for ongoing savings. They are nationally available in hospitals and for homecare use.

📋 Description

• Develop and execute brand commercialization strategies for the pediatric medical nutrition product portfolio, addressing market needs, competitive dynamics, and annual business objectives. • Work closely with the brand team to integrate pediatric medical nutrition product portfolio initiatives into the overall annual marketing plan, ensuring consistency with Kate Farms’ brand framework across all products and campaigns. • Collaborate with cross-functional teams (e.g., Sales, Supply Chain, Product Development, Business Operations) to optimize portfolio potential, identify market gaps, and develop actionable strategies. • Leverage brand equity tracking to develop audience-specific targeting strategies for healthcare professionals (HCPs), caregivers, and pediatric patients to drive engagement and adoption. • Partner with Consumer Insights and Analytics teams to refine targeting efforts based on segmentation, behavior, and feedback data. • Lead pricing strategy development for the pediatric medical nutrition portfolio, ensuring alignment with business objectives and market conditions while optimizing profitability and access across healthcare, eCommerce, and retail channels. • Conduct competitive analyses and regular pricing reviews to recommend strategic adjustments, collaborating with Finance, Revenue Operations, and sales channels to ensure consistent execution across all channels. • Oversee go-to-market strategies for new product introductions (NPIs), including launch plans, media strategies, and cross-functional execution. • Manage product lifecycle initiatives, such as reformulations, packaging updates, and portfolio expansions, to sustain relevance and growth. • Conduct post-launch evaluations to measure effectiveness, track results, and propose refinements for future initiatives. • Lead integrated omnichannel marketing campaign strategy designed to engage both healthcare professionals and consumers, driving retention and sales across DTC, retail, and Amazon channels. • Develop consumer and HCP journeys that map key touchpoints, from awareness to loyalty, ensuring seamless experiences across digital, in-person, and professional channels. • Create messaging and campaigns tailored to pediatric-focused audiences, leveraging digital tools, professional education initiatives, and caregiver-focused content to drive engagement and advocacy. • Partner with Brand Marketing team to ensure strategy is executed flawlessly across campaign messaging and creative. • Track key performance indicators (KPIs) for campaigns and portfolio performance, leveraging insights to refine marketing strategies and improve outcomes. • Monitor competitive activity, customer needs, and feedback to continuously optimize strategies for pediatric medical nutrition products. • Partner with the Consumer and HCP Insights teams to conduct brand and audience research, aligning marketing efforts with emerging trends and behaviors. • Provide input on forecasting, tracking, and advertising and promotion (A&P) budgeting for the pediatric medical nutrition product portfolio. • Work collaboratively with the Trade and Sales teams (Retail, katefarms.com, and Amazon.com) to integrate market insights into annual budget plans and tactical campaigns.
